20x16 image printed on 26x22 Fine Art Rag Paper with 3" (76mm) white border. Our Fine Art Prints are printed on 300gsm 100% acid free, PH neutral paper with archival properties. This printing method is used by museums and art collections to exhibit photographs and art reproductions.

Our fine art prints are high-quality prints made using a paper called Photo Rag. This 100% cotton rag fibre paper is known for its exceptional image sharpness, rich colors, and high level of detail, making it a popular choice for professional photographers and artists. This print showcases the remarkable Elephant Temple at Musawwarat es-Sufra, located south of Shendi in Sudan. Belonging to the Meroitic Period of the Kingdom of Cush, this ancient temple dates back to approximately 270BC to 350AD. The temple's most intriguing feature is its statues of elephants, which depict Indian elephants due to their distinctive appearance. Nestled amidst the vast Sahara Desert, this place of worship holds immense historical and religious significance.
